Product description

This additive free, higher proof blanco tequila originates from Mexico, produced in the Los Altos region of Jalisco. Founded by Arturo Lamas III to honour his family's agave heritage, the spirit is crafted under Master Distiller Sergio Cruz at the renowned Feliciano Vivanco y Asociados distillery (NOM 1414) in Arandas. Selected as a special single cask release for the Southern Ontario Sippers (SOS) community group, this expression is made from mature Highland Blue Weber agave cooked in traditional stone and brick ovens, open air fermented with champagne yeast, and double distilled in copper pot stills.

Spirit Description

This unaged single cask tequila presents a crystal clear, luminous appearance with rich viscosity in the glass. The nose opens with expressive notes of sweet cooked agave, vibrant lime peel, and garden herbs, supported by wet stone minerality, subtle olive brine, and cracked black pepper. On the palate, it delivers a full, slightly oily mouthfeel that balances intense roasted agave sweetness with citrus zest, spearmint, and earthy minerality, underscored by concentrated pepper spice. The finish is long, warming, and savoury, leaving a lingering impression of sweet agave, herbal freshness, subtle salinity, and pepper spice. Bottled at a higher strength of 46% ABV, this Cask 004 release offers exceptional intensity, texture, and spirit balance.
